Job description

A rewarding opportunity is available for a Pharmacy Pharmacist ready to provide expert pharmaceutical care in the Upper Peninsula of Michigan. This contract position offers the chance to bring your skills to a smaller community setting, where your impact on patient health and medication management will be direct and meaningful.

Responsibilities include accurately dispensing medications, counseling patients on proper medication usage, collaborating with healthcare teams to optimize drug therapy, and ensuring compliance with all regulatory requirements. The role demands vigilance in prescription review and the ability to manage multiple tasks efficiently in a smaller pharmacy environment.

Desired Experience:

  • Licensed Pharmacist with active registration to practice pharmacy.
  • Proven expertise in prescription processing and medication counseling.
  • Strong knowledge of pharmaceutical formulations and drug interactions.
  • Excellent communication skills and attention to detail.
  • Adaptability to work in a smaller, community-focused healthcare setting.
  • Ability to travel and relocate temporarily within Michigan’s Upper Peninsula.

Location:

  • Upper Peninsula, Michigan
